Birbarpur
Birbarpur is a village located in Narayangarh subdivision of Paschim Medinipur district in West Bengal, India. Midnapur and Belda are the district & sub-district headquarters of Birbarpur village respectively. As per 2009 stats, Bakhrabad is the gram panchayat of Birbarpur village.

About Birbarpur
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Birbarpur is 343372. The village spans a total geographical area of 153.38 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 721436. Kharagpur is nearest town to Birbarpur village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 43km away.

Population of Birbarpur
According to the 2011 Census, Birbarpur has a total population of about 846, with approximately 405 males and 441 females. The sex ratio is around 1088 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 105 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 326 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 118. The overall literacy rate is approximately 76.95%, with male literacy at about 80.25% and female literacy near 73.92%. There are around 177 households in the village. Connectivity of Birbarpur
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Birbarpur. As per the 2011 stats, Birbarpur had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
